What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Burbank to Bozeman?

The average price of all flights from Burbank to Bozeman cl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
When flying from Burbank to Bozeman, you should consider leaving on a Wednesday and avoid Sundays if you are looking for the best rates. For your return to Burbank, you’ll find the best rates on Saturdays and the most expensive ones on Sundays.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Burbank to Bozeman?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Burbank to Bozeman,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Burbank to Bozeman is January, where tickets cost $218 on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are November and October, where the average cost of tickets is $423 and $418 respectively.

Which airlines fly non-stop between Burbank and Bozeman?

Airline and price data is aggregated from results in KAYAK’s search results from the last 2 weeks for flights from Burbank to Bozeman.
There is just one airline that flies from Burbank to Bozeman direct and that is Avelo Airlines. The best one-way deal found from Avelo Airlines for the route is $64.

How many flights are there between Burbank and Bozeman per day?

There is a maximum of 1 nonstop flight a day that takes off from Burbank and lands in Bozeman, with an average flight time of 2h 30m. The most common departure time is 7:00 am and most flights take off in the morning. Each week, there are 2 flights.

How long does a flight from Burbank to Bozeman take?

Nonstop flights from Burbank generally make it to Bozeman in 2h 30m. The flying distance between the two cities is 885 miles.

What’s the earliest departure time from Burbank to Bozeman?

Early birds can take the earliest flight from Burbank at 7:00 am and will be landing in Bozeman at 10:30 am.

  • Which airports will I be using when flying from Burbank to Bozeman?

    Burbank and Bozeman are both served by 1 main airport. You will leave Burbank from Burbank Bob Hope and will be arriving at Bozeman Gallatin Field.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Burbank to Bozeman?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Bozeman with an airline and back to Burbank with another airline. Booking your flights between Burbank and BZN can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.

Avelo is definitely a budget airline and you get what you pay for. The plane was packed and the seats were not particularly comfortable. Staff was very nice and both of our flights were on time. The one thing I wish I had known was that the staff does not show up at the airport desk to check your bags until two hours before the flight. We had a 4:30 flight and had to check out of our hotel at noon. Since we have lounge passes we planned to check our bag, go through security and hang out at the lounge until we had to board. But because we could not check our bag until 2:30, when the staff showed up, we could not go through security and access the lounge. Passengers with boarding passes and carry on luggage would not have this issue. I might fly Avelo again but would only do carry on or plan to get to the airport no sooner than two hours before check in. And I would not recommend a long flight on Avelo since there is no food or entertainment and the seats are not comfortable.
